EDITORS COMMENTS
This 19th century print, titled "Neptune and His Hippocampi," transports us back to the mythological world of ancient Greece. Neptune, the Roman equivalent of the Greek god Poseidon, is depicted in regal splendor as he rides his chariot across the vast, shimmering sea. The god of the sea is shown in classical pose, with his muscular form clad in flowing robes and adorned with a trident, the symbol of his power. Surrounding Neptune are his loyal Hippocampi, mythical creatures who were half horse and half fish. These enchanting beasts, with their flowing manes and tails, gracefully draw Neptune's chariot through the waves. In this print, they are shown in mid-gallop, their powerful limbs propelling the chariot forward with ease. Neptune's trident is raised in a salute, as if in acknowledgement of the music of the sea that accompanies his journey. The god's serene expression and the tranquil waters around him convey a sense of peace and harmony, despite the raw power and energy of the scene. Tritons, Neptune's attendants, can be seen frolicking in the waves alongside the chariot. Their playful antics add a lighthearted touch to the otherwise grandiose scene. This print, created circa 1860, is a stunning example of historical artistry and a testament to the enduring allure of Greek mythology.
